
Could key climate talks mark ground zero in global push to ditch fossil fuels?
🤖AI Özeti
Colombia recently hosted a significant conference attended by nearly 60 countries, focusing on the transition from fossil fuels to clean energy. The event marked a bold step for Colombia as it seeks to shift its economy away from coal, gas, and oil. This initiative aims to reduce the global dependence on fossil fuels and promote a sustainable energy future.

The backdrop of this conference is the increasing urgency of climate change and the need for nations to adopt sustainable practices. Colombia, traditionally reliant on fossil fuel exports, is now positioning itself as a leader in the clean energy transition, reflecting a broader global trend towards sustainability.
